Maîtriser l'Itération et l'Unpacking en Python
L' itération et l' unpacking sont des concepts clés en Python. Découvrez comment les utiliser efficacement.
Introduction







Logique de contrôle de flux














Types avancés










Les fonctions










Créer un programme complet : explorateur d'historique web
Ecosystème autour de Python







La programmation orientée objet en Python







Détails de la leçon
Description de la leçon
Cette leçon aborde l' itération, un concept fondamental en Python, en proposant une exploration détaillée des outils et fonctions qui permettent de parcourir des collections d'éléments un par un. Vous apprendrez comment utiliser des fonctions natives comme max
qui acceptent différents itérables tels que les listes, les tuples et les sets.
Nous introduirons ensuite l' unpacking, une technique puissante permettant d'assigner les éléments d'une collection à des variables en une seule opération. Vous découvrirez comment créer et manipuler des tuples sans ambiguïté, en utilisant principalement la virgule comme opérateur. Enfin, la vidéo couvre des cas particuliers d'unpacking avec des collections de tailles différentes et comment gérer les erreurs potentielles, ainsi que l' unpacking dans le contexte des dictionnaires.
Objectifs de cette leçon
Les objectifs de cette vidéo sont de:
- Comprendre l'importance de l'itération en Python
- Apprendre à utiliser les fonctions natives avec différents itérables
- Maîtriser l'unpacking pour assigner les éléments d'une collection à des variables
- Savoir gérer des collections de tailles différentes avec l'unpacking
Prérequis pour cette leçon
Il est recommandé d'avoir des connaissances de base en Python, notamment la manipulation des listes, des tuples et des sets.
Métiers concernés
Les concepts abordés dans cette vidéo sont particulièrement utiles pour les développeurs logiciels, les ingénieurs en données, et les analystes travaillant avec des grands ensembles de données et nécessitant une manipulation efficace des collections en Python.
Alternatives et ressources
Pour les itérations, d'autres langages de programmation tels que JavaScript, Java, ou C++ offrent également des moyens de parcourir des collections. En termes de unpacking, les langages comme Ruby et PHP proposent des fonctionnalités similaires.
Questions & Réponses
